Ryzen 5 3600 vs Ryzen 5 5500GT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

AMD

Ryzen 5 3600

The Ryzen 5 3600 is manufactured by AMD. It was released in 7 July 2019 (6 years ago). It is based on the Matisse (2019−2020) architecture. It features 6 cores and 12 threads. Base frequency is 3.6 GHz, with boost up to 4.2 GHz. L3 cache: 32 MB (total). L2 cache: 512K (per core). Built on 7 nm, 12 nm process technology. Socket: AM4. Thermal design power (TDP): 65 Watt. Memory support: DDR4 Dual-channel. Passmark benchmark score: 17,685 points. Launch price was $199.

AMD

Ryzen 5 5500GT

The Ryzen 5 5500GT is manufactured by AMD. It was released in 8 January 2024 (1 year ago). It is based on the Cezanne (2021−2025) architecture. It features 6 cores and 12 threads. Base frequency is 3.6 GHz, with boost up to 4.4 GHz. L3 cache: 16 MB. L2 cache: 512 kB (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 65 Watt. Memory support: DDR4. Passmark benchmark score: 18,846 points. Launch price was $125.

Processing Power

Both the Ryzen 5 3600 and Ryzen 5 5500GT share an identical 6-core/12-thread configuration. Boost clocks reach 4.2 GHz on the Ryzen 5 3600 versus 4.4 GHz on the Ryzen 5 5500GT — a 4.7% clock advantage for the Ryzen 5 5500GT (base: 3.6 GHz vs 3.6 GHz). The Ryzen 5 3600 uses the Matisse (2019−2020) architecture (7 nm, 12 nm), while the Ryzen 5 5500GT uses Cezanne (2021−2025) (7 nm). In PassMark, the Ryzen 5 3600 scores 17,685 against the Ryzen 5 5500GT's 18,846 — a 6.4% lead for the Ryzen 5 5500GT. Cinebench R23 multi-core: 9,500 vs 10,500 (10% advantage for the Ryzen 5 5500GT). Geekbench 6 single-core — the metric most relevant to gaming — records 1,295 vs 1,412, a 8.6% lead for the Ryzen 5 5500GT that directly translates to higher frame rates. Multi-core Geekbench: 1,898 vs 8,514 (127.1% advantage for the Ryzen 5 5500GT). L3 cache: 32 MB (total) on the Ryzen 5 3600 vs 16 MB on the Ryzen 5 5500GT.

Memory & Platform

Both processors use the AM4 socket with PCIe 4.0. Both support up to DDR4-3200 memory speed. Both support up to 128 GB of RAM. Both feature 2-channel memory with ECC support. Both provide 24 PCIe lanes. Chipset compatibility: AMD B550,AMD X570,AMD B450,AMD X470 (Ryzen 5 3600) and A520,B450,B550,X470,X570 (Ryzen 5 5500GT).

Advanced Features

Both processors feature an unlocked multiplier for overclocking. Virtualization support: Yes (Ryzen 5 3600) vs AMD-V (Ryzen 5 5500GT). The Ryzen 5 5500GT includes integrated graphics (Radeon Vega 7), while the Ryzen 5 3600 requires a dedicated GPU. Primary use case: Ryzen 5 3600 targets Gaming/Budget Workstation, Ryzen 5 5500GT targets Budget. Direct competitor: Ryzen 5 3600 rivals Core i5-10400; Ryzen 5 5500GT rivals Core i5-12400.
